Beijing Capital International Airport → Amsterdam Airport Schiphol

PEKAMS
Distance
7,826 km · 4,862 mi
Flight time
10h 32m
CO₂ per passenger
704 kg

This Beijing Capital International Airport → Amsterdam Airport Schiphol route is 7,826 km (4,862 mi) end to end. The estimated flight time is 10h 32m, and a passenger's share of CO₂ works out at roughly 704 kg.

Beijing Capital International Airport to Amsterdam Airport Schiphol FAQ

How far is Beijing Capital International Airport from Amsterdam Airport Schiphol?
Beijing Capital International Airport (PEK) and Amsterdam Airport Schiphol (AMS) are 7,826 km (4,862 mi) apart, measured along the great-circle route.
How long is the flight from Beijing Capital International Airport to Amsterdam Airport Schiphol?
A direct PEK–AMS flight covers the distance in about 10h 32m, though the exact time shifts with aircraft type and winds.
How much CO₂ does a flight from Beijing Capital International Airport to Amsterdam Airport Schiphol produce?
A passenger's share of CO₂ on the PEK–AMS route is roughly 704 kg.
Which airlines fly from Beijing Capital International Airport to Amsterdam Airport Schiphol?
KLM operate scheduled service between PEK and AMS.

Flight distance and time are estimates for ideal conditions — actual figures vary with aircraft type, routing and weather.
